How they compare
Kazakhstan currently reports 2.4% against 1.1% in Saudi Arabia, a difference of 1.3%.
That makes Kazakhstan's figure about 2.1 times Saudi Arabia's.
The two have swapped places 5 times across 75 shared years of data; in 1950 it was Saudi Arabia ahead.
Kazakhstan ranks 13th and Saudi Arabia ranks 14th of 215 countries.
Across the 8 decades both report, Kazakhstan averaged higher in 4 and Saudi Arabia in 3.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Kazakhstan | Saudi Arabia |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1950s | 0.0% | 0.0% | 0.0% | — |
| 1960s | 0.0% | 2.9% | 2.9% | Saudi Arabia |
| 1970s | 0.4% | 16.2% | 15.9% | Saudi Arabia |
| 1980s | 0.8% | 9.8% | 9.0% | Saudi Arabia |
| 1990s | 2.0% | 1.3% | 0.7% | Kazakhstan |
| 2000s | 3.1% | 2.2% | 0.9% | Kazakhstan |
| 2010s | 3.5% | 1.2% | 2.4% | Kazakhstan |
| 2020s | 2.5% | 1.0% | 1.4% | Kazakhstan |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
